In collaboration with The Seattle Times, Big Local News is providing full-text nursing home deficiencies from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S). These files contain the full narrative details of each nursing home deficiency cited regulators. The files include deficiencies from Standard Surveys (routine inspections) and from Complaint Surveys. Complete data begins January 2011 (although some earlier inspections do show up). Individual states are provides as CSV files. A very large (4.5GB) national file is also provided as a zipped archive. New data will be updated on a monthly basis. For additional documentation, please see the README.

1959 LAKE CITY SCRANTON HEALTHCARE CENTER 425149 1940 BOYD ROAD SCRANTON SC 29591 2018-01-26 574 B 0 1 OHH911 Based on observation, interview and record review, the facility failed to ensure The Resident Council was aware of how to file a complaint with the South [NAME]ina State Survey Agency for 1 of 1 Resident Council meetings. The findings included: During The Resident Council Group Meeting held on 01/ 18/18 at 02:04 PM the residents stated they did not receive information on how to file a complaint with the state. The only person who knew about the Ombudsman was a resident who was in rehab and stated she was told at her Assisted Living placement facility. During an interview on 01/26/18 at 05:30 PM, the Activities Director verified that she had not discussed in the resident council meetings about how to file a grievance with the state, but she does tell them where the phone numbers are posted.
